About Freestar:

Freestar engineers cutting-edge monetization solutions for websites. By combining industry-leading technology, data, and massive scale, we enable busy site owners to seamlessly maximize revenue while freeing themselves of the hassles of ad operations. Publishers then have more time to do what they do best: create content.

Job Description:

Reporting to the VP of Architecture, the Senior DevOps Engineer is a core member of the Freestar Platform Team, responsible for the reliability, security, efficiency, and evolution of our global, customer-facing infrastructure. The Platform Team's mission is to enable our product and engineering teams to deliver high-quality software rapidly and reliably by providing a scalable, automated, and secure foundation.

In this role, you will join a team of skilled engineers to work on strategic projects to enhance system reliability and efficiency, and increase deployment velocity across the organization. You will also work in close collaboration with Engineering and Product teams to provide cross-functional infrastructure and operational support.

Our ideal candidate thrives on solving complex technical challenges in a fast-paced environment, supporting multiple projects, and is committed to maintaining high technical standards through automated workflows and the engineering of a resilient, scalable foundation.

Responsibilities:

  • Cross-Functional Support: Act as the primary technical point of contact for Engineering and Product teams, providing daily operational support for Platform requests.
  • Infrastructure & Cloud Management: Design, deploy, and manage scalable services on GCP.
  • Automation & CI/CD: Build and optimize repeatable deployment pipelines and deployment blueprints.
  • Cost Optimization: Monitor cloud expenditure and implement right-sizing initiatives to support departmental cost-reduction goals.
  • Reliability & Monitoring: Maintain comprehensive monitoring and alerting frameworks to ensure high availability and lead rapid incident response for critical systems.
  • Security & Compliance: Execute stack-hardening tasks, including vulnerability scanning, access control audits, and secrets detection.
  • System Maintenance: Manage the ongoing updates, patching, and maintenance of platform components.

Qualifications:

  • Experience: 5–7 years in DevOps, SRE, or Cloud Engineering with a focus on high-availability production environments.
  • Cloud Expertise: 3+ years of deep, hands-on experience with major cloud providers (GCP preferred, AWS, or Azure), including cloud architecture, resiliency, and disaster recovery.
  • Infrastructure as Code: Expert-level proficiency with Terraform and a "policy as code" mindset.
  • Containers & Orchestration: Advanced knowledge of Docker and Kubernetes, including image management and cluster administration.
  • Programming & Scripting: Strong fundamentals in Python, Shell, or equivalent languages for automation and tool building.
  • CI/CD & DevOps Tooling: Proven experience building and maintaining modern pipelines (GitHub Actions, JFrog, CloudBuild) 
  • Networking & SecOps: Solid understanding of cloud networking (VPCs, Firewalls) and security practices, including IAM, secrets management, and vulnerability scanning.

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
